# Giftpost receipt mailer — env notes
# Heads up for the release manager: this file drives the donation-receipt
# mailer for the Larkmoor charity drive. SMTP host and sender name are set
# above; template paths are baked into the image, so don't touch those.
# Rotate nothing during the drive window unless mail is actually bouncing.
# The mailer signs each receipt batch with a key, which goes on the next line.

sealed setting: VAULT_KEY5=0924b

Welcome to the PointsPal support rotation! Quick primer: every customer's loyalty balance lives in the Tallyworks ledger, and it's append-only — we never edit rows, we only add corrections. If a member disputes a balance, pull their ledger view first, then file an adjustment through Marisol's queue. One more thing: to unlock the read-replica console during an outage, you'll need the shared recovery passphrase. It rotates quarterly, so don't memorize old ones. Here's the current one:

strongbox words: zorox-holix

Welcome to the Schedulr team. One recurring issue you'll hear about in the weekly sync is the calendar sync conflict between our Tidewater booking service and the legacy Roomfinder agent: both attempt to write availability blocks, and last-writer-wins occasionally drops meetings. The interim fix routes all writes through the Tidewater reconciliation queue, which you can exercise locally with the sandbox tools. To run the reconciliation integration tests on your machine, configure the sandbox client with the internal key provided below.

app token of kajop-tahag = qvz23-qaEp6MzrfP2AwhVbZwsZeUq